Surface Transportation Extension Act of 2015 This bill amends the Highway and Transportation Funding Act of 2014 to extend through July 31, 2015, the authorization, including authorized amount of appropriations, for: federal-aid highway programs generally, National Highway Traffic Safety Administration highway safety programs, and Federal Motor Carrier Safety Administration programs. The authorization of appropriations for programs under the Dingell-Johnson Sport Fish Restoration Act is also extended through July 31, 2015. The bill extends through the same date the authorization and apportionment of appropriations for formula grants, including those for rural areas, public transportation, and bus and bus facilities. Appropriations are authorized through that date for hazardous materials emergency preparedness and training grants. Expenditure authorities of the Internal Revenue Code are also extended through July 31, 2015, for the Highway, Sport Fish Restoration and Boating, and Leaking Underground Storage Tank Trust Funds.
